
Steelhawks Set for Home Opener Saturday
March 2, 2016 - American Indoor Football (AIF)
Lehigh Valley Steelhawks News Release
Allentown, PA: The Lehigh Valley Steelhawks 2016 professional arena football Home Opener inside the PPL Center on Embassy Bank Field is this Saturday, March 5th at 7:00pm. New season, new league, but some familiar faces will be on the opposing team bench when the Hawks take the field for the first time in the American Indoor Football League (AIF) against the Philadelphia Yellow Jackets.
Fans should remember a few big names from the Yellow Jackets roster; DB/KR Jesse Cooper, and QB Warren Smith. Cooper is a former Steelhawk that holds the team record for all-time interceptions. Smith spent last season in the AFL with the Spokane Shock, but the Hawks defended him when he was in the PIFL, playing for the Trenton Freedom and Richmond Raiders. Philadelphia also has several other players and coaches that spent time with the Trenton Freedom last season. That familiarity on the field and the close proximity geographically, coupled with the fact that the teams will see each other twice this season should make for an intense and exciting rivalry right from the start.
Smith and Cooper are the main weapons the Hawks need to be aware of. Defensively, keeping Smith contained in the pocket will be key. Cooper is an explosive returner so the Hawks will look to avoid having him touch the ball on any kick.
Lehigh Valley has a core of veterans that led the team during camp and rookies to the team have stepped up to fill in around them. WR Brandon Renford is the team's all-time leading receiver and has found chemistry with QB's Clay Belton and Jake Jablonski. Defensively, DL Larry Ford (LV's all-time sack leader) is joined in the front line by returning studs DL Tahir Basil and DL/LB Chris Alvarez. In the backfield, veterans Ken Walton (Nashville Venom) and John Williams (ASI Panthers), will be top defensive threats.
Head Coach Chris Thompson is excited for the first game of 2016 to be in the Valley, "The return to the PPL Center and Embassy Bank Field is finally here. We have an unbelievable first test in the new league with the Philadelphia Yellow Jackets coming to town. They have an outstanding experienced coaching staff and roster of players that have been great in this game, like Cooper and Smith. So, we are going to have to be on all cylinders Saturday night to start the season off the way we want to. I'm glad we do it at home in front of our awesome 9th man."
